Call for Papers

---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
The 8th Workshop on Many-Task Computing on Clouds, Grids, and 
Supercomputers (MTAGS) 2015
http://datasys.cs.iit.edu/events/MTAGS15/
---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
November 15th, 2015
Austin, Texas, USA

Co-located with with IEEE/ACM International Conference for
High Performance Computing, Networking, Storage and Analysis (SC15)

=======================================================================================
The 8th workshop on Many-Task Computing on Clouds, Grids, and 
Supercomputers (MTAGS) will provide the scientific community a dedicated 
forum for presenting new research, development, and deployment efforts 
of large-scale many-task computing (MTC) applications on large scale 
clusters, Grids, Supercomputers, and Cloud Computing infrastructure. 
MTC, the theme of the workshop encompasses loosely coupled applications, 
which are generally composed of many tasks (both independent and 
dependent tasks) to achieve some larger application goal.  This workshop 
will cover challenges that can hamper efficiency and utilization in 
running applications on large-scale systems, such as local resource 
manager scalability and granularity, efficient utilization of raw 
hardware, parallel file system contention and scalability, data 
management, I/O management, reliability at scale, and application 
scalability. We welcome paper submissions on all theoretical, 
simulations, and systems topics related to MTC, but we give special 
consideration to papers addressing petascale to exascale challenges. 
Papers will be peer-reviewed for novelty, scientific merit, and scope 
for the workshop. The workshop will be co-located with the IEEE/ACM 
Supercomputing 2015 Conference in Austin Texas on November 15th, 2015.

Topics
---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
We invite the submission of original work that is related to the topics 
below. The papers should be 6 pages, including all figures and 
references.We aim to cover topics related to Many-Task Computing on each 
of the three major distributed systems paradigms, Cloud Computing, Grid 
Computing and Supercomputing. Topics of interest include:
* Compute Resource Management
   * Scheduling
   * Job execution frameworks
   * Local resource manager extensions
   * Performance evaluation of resource managers in use on large scale 
systems
   * Dynamic resource provisioning
   * Techniques to manage many-core resources and/or GPUs
   * Challenges and opportunities in running many-task workloads on HPC 
systems
   * Challenges and opportunities in running many-task workloads on 
Cloud Computing infrastructure
* Storage architectures and implementations
   * Distributed file systems
   * Parallel file systems
   * Distributed meta-data management
   * Content distribution systems for large data
   * Data caching frameworks and techniques
   * Data management within and across data centers
   * Data-aware scheduling
   * Data-intensive computing applications
   * Eventual-consistency storage usage and management
* Programming models and tools
   * Map-reduce and its generalizations
   * Many-task computing middleware and applications
   * Parallel programming frameworks
   * Ensemble MPI techniques and frameworks
   * Service-oriented science applications
* Large-Scale Workflow Systems
   * Workflow system performance and scalability analysis
   * Scalability of workflow systems
   * Workflow infrastructure and e-Science middleware
   * Programming Paradigms and Models
* Large-Scale Many-Task Applications
   * High-throughput computing (HTC) applications
   * Data-intensive applications
   * Quasi-supercomputing applications, deployments, and experiences
   * Performance Evaluation
* Performance evaluation
   * Real systems
   * Simulations
   * Reliability of large systems
